Mage rotation is more than just Frostbolt.... sure on any single target you spam that and use CDs if you have them (trinkets/ AP). But across the whole raid, a lot of your damage comes from Arcane Explosion, Cone of Cold, Flame Strike, Fire Blast and Blizzard. Only fire elementals are purely immune to fire in MC. Squeezing in a Fireblast when you don't have time to bolt, and using flame strike in most AOE spots works. (Always drop a flame strike before blizzard channel or AE/ CoC spam.)
